第一步:在res目录下建立raw文件夹

第二步:MediaPlayer music = MediaPlayer.create(this, MusicId);

第三步:music.start();

例子如下:

package com.example.test;

import android.app.Activity;
import android.media.MediaPlayer;
import android.os.Bundle;
import android.view.View;
import android.view.View.OnClickListener;
import android.widget.Button;
import android.widget.ExpandableListView;

public class MainActivity extends Activity {
      private ExpandableListView expandableListView;
      private MediaPlayer music = null;// 播放器引用 
@Override
    prot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);
    Button button = (Button) findViewById(R.id.btn);
  
    button.setOnClickListener(new OnClickListener() {

@Override
public void onClick(View arg0) {
PlayMusic(R.raw.button_select_sound);
}
});
    }
private void PlayMusic(int MusicId) {

music = MediaPlayer.create(this, MusicId);
music.start();

}

}

android点击按钮发出声音相关推荐

  1. java点击按钮发出声音_java – 按下按钮时播放声音-android

    我有这个代码 package com.tct.soundTouch; import android.app.Activity; import android.media.MediaPlayer; im ...

  2. java点击按钮发出声音_响应触发按钮声音onKeyPress问题

    我正在学习React并致力于构建drum machine . 我在按钮点击时使用onKeyPress触发声音时遇到问题 . 使用鼠标单击时按钮和声音工作正常,但为了让它们在键盘上工作,您首先必须用鼠标 ...

  3. MFC点击按钮发出声音_playsound_循环/单次播放_声音文件加入程序中

    在VC++的程序设计中,可以利用各种标准的资源,如位图,菜单,对话框等.同时VC++也允许用户自定义资源,因此我们可以将声音文件作为用户自定义资源加入程序资源文件中,经过编译连接生成EXE文件,实现无 ...

  4. Android 点击按钮切换图片

    Android 点击按钮切换图片 效果如图: 点击后: 主要代码: //切换图片 but1.setBackgroundResource(R.drawable.qq1); 全部代码: public cl ...

  5. Android 点击按钮带有震动效果,使用Vibrator

    Vibrator 振动器,是手机自带的振动器哦,不要想成岛国用的那种神秘东西哦~~ Vibrator是Android给我们提供的用于机身震动的一个服务哦 更多详情可见官方API文档:Vibrator ...

  6. 点击按钮触发声音(xaml实现)

    当点击按钮时,播放按钮声音,xaml代码如下: <Button Content="播放声音" ><Button.Triggers><EventTrig ...

  7. android 点击按钮来回切换图片

    android 点击切换图片 适合初学者,没什么好说的,很简单,不过方法我觉得挺精妙的. 1.添加图片 气死我了,选下面那个会报错(好像是因为分辨率太高(?)还是像素太高,忘了) activity_m ...

  8. android点击按钮打开一个网页,Android实现H5点击打开app或跳转指定界面

    Android实现H5点击打开app或跳转指定界面 本文原创,转载请注明出处.欢迎关注我的 简书. 安利一波我写的开发框架:MyScFrame喜欢的话就给个Star 场景 H5界面中的入口 有时候为了 ...

  9. android点击按钮弹出图片,用android做的一个简单的点击按钮显示图片的程序

    其实,在这之前我已经做了一个点击按钮的小程序,只不过它只是用来在界面上显示一些文字或者是用一个对话框来显示内容.按理说,做显示图片应该是不会有太大的问题了,可是问题还是来了.在我把这些个问题解决之后, ...

最新文章

  1. 在ssh项目中的中配置数据源c3p0
  2. ISCC2020-Web题解
  3. 将span隐藏的函数_分类汇总函数Subtotal和Aggregate应用技巧解读
  4. Linux的Open Files设置过小导致程序退出并且Unable to create new native thread
  5. 源码角度,分析@Transactional实现原理
  6. Uva 140 Bandwidth
  7. 面向对象及os模块、socket模块
  8. 【alpha】Scrum站立会议第4次....10.19
  9. java string 去掉两边的引号_编写一个简单的java程序
  10. win10网络计算机显示不全,win10系统局域网显示计算机设备不完全的解决方法
  11. 基于领域模型的微服务划分--实战案例解析
  12. 如何使用 PyTorch 训练自定义关键点检测模型
  13. python发微信工资条_使用python自动发放员工工资条到个人邮箱
  14. 腾讯视频QLV文件格式转换MP4格式
  15. 谁会成为印度版微信?
  16. 从0到ros2玩rmf
  17. 这些年我要读的书【不断更新中】
  18. MASM32编程完善SysInfo遇到奇怪故障,真切感受全局变量和局部变量之别……
  19. mac 爱普生打印机驱动_epson l360 mac版驱动下载-爱普生l360驱动Mac版最新版 - 极光下载站...
  20. 【LAS 】全球智能网络传输竞赛2018 : 基于DASH

热门文章

  1. 【C51开发应用】基于C51单片机开发的循迹灭火机器人
  2. Charles抓包工具测试实战
  3. 大数据的架构设计与未来
  4. neo4j图形数据库Java应用
  5. 解决pdf不能打印,不能注释,不能修改,不能保存等文档限制
  6. SQL基础语法学习总结
  7. oracle导出数据一闪就没,Pl/Sql 导入dmp文件时窗口一闪而过
  8. 软件工程之软件设计阶段
  9. 区块链未来三年内将广泛落地
  10. 第一篇博客----试水